The company partners with farms across six continents, with major production hubs in California, Spain, and Brazil. Despite not owning the farms, Heinz maintains quality control by processing all seeds at its own facility and sending them out to a global network of private growers. All of the brand's ketchup employs fruit from specific Heinz tomato varieties. The brand has been breeding its own type since 1934 and maintaining close partnerships with its global roster of farmers.
